Portugal - Thursday

Today we headed East for the first time and visited the historic town of Tavira. We had a drink in the a cafe which made Fawlty Towers look organised. Three times we had to ask for some milk for K's tea - by the time we got it, the tea was almost cold. We were watching other tables and everyone else was also getting the same exceptional service - we just laughed about it... and didn't tip!

Tavira itself was very pretty and the castle offered some terrific views of the town; as well as a shady flower garden that K enjoyed photographing.

After Tavira, we headed along the coast to Santa Luzia and then Pedras d'El Rei. SL was a sleepy place but very pretty, we had a walk along the front then sat on a bench warming our bones. In Pedras, we walked out to and island nature reserve called Ilha de Tavira - it was very pretty and peaceful. The marshy land reminded us of a hot version of Blakeney!

Dinner was in the hotel restaurant with a drink in the bar afterwards. I don't know whether it's the big meals, or the heat, or the fresh air, or a combination of all three but we're done in by the time we go to bed. Lucky we can lie in!
